fix(media-request): add missing completed status (#2990)

This commit is contained in:
Meier Lukas
2025-05-01 10:08:19 +02:00
committed by GitHub
parent a2934247b2
commit 9006d3d2fc
3 changed files with 4 additions and 1 deletions

View File

@@ -48,6 +48,7 @@ export enum MediaRequestStatus {
Approved = 2,
Declined = 3,
Failed = 4,
Completed = 5,
}
export enum MediaAvailability {

View File

@@ -1949,7 +1949,8 @@
"pending": "Pending",
"approved": "Approved",
"declined": "Declined",
"failed": "Failed"
"failed": "Failed",
"completed": "Completed"
},
"toBeDetermined": "TBD"
},

View File

@@ -215,6 +215,7 @@ const statusMapping = {
[MediaRequestStatus.Approved]: { color: "green", label: (t) => t("approved") },
[MediaRequestStatus.Declined]: { color: "red", label: (t) => t("declined") },
[MediaRequestStatus.Failed]: { color: "red", label: (t) => t("failed") },
[MediaRequestStatus.Completed]: { color: "green", label: (t) => t("completed") },
} satisfies Record<
MediaRequestStatus,
{